public class Real2ProxyPVUpdate extends Real2ProxyMsg
Real2ProxyMsg.Type
Modifier and Type | Field and Description |
---|---|
double |
acceleration
The acceleration of the vehicle
|
AccelSchedule |
accelProfile
The acceleration profile
|
double |
heading
The direction of the vehicle
|
Point2D |
position
The position of the vehicle, represented by the point at
the center of the front of the Vehicle.
|
double |
steeringAngle
The steering angle
|
double |
targetVelocity
The velocity at which the driver would like to be traveling.
|
double |
velocity
The velocity of the vehicle
|
int |
vin
The vehicle's identification number.
|
messageType, receivedTime
Constructor and Description |
---|
Real2ProxyPVUpdate(DataInputStream dis,
double receivedTime)
Create a real vehicle to proxy vehicle message for PV update message.
|
public final int vin
public final Point2D position
public final double heading
public final double steeringAngle
public double velocity
public final double targetVelocity
public final double acceleration
public final AccelSchedule accelProfile
public Real2ProxyPVUpdate(DataInputStream dis, double receivedTime) throws IOException
dis
- the I/O streamreceivedTime
- the time stampIOException
Copyright © 2013. All rights reserved.